Sir William Herschel observed Uranus on 13 March 1781 from the garden of his house at 19 New King Street in Bath, Somerset, England (now the Herschel Museum of Astronomy),[27] and initially reported it (on 26 April 1781) as a comet. Its average distance from the Sun is roughly 20AU (3billionkm; 2billionmi). The Uranian axis of rotation is approximately parallel with the plane of the Solar System, with an axial tilt of 97.77 (as defined by prograde rotation). [12] The largest of Uranus's satellites, Titania, has a radius of only 788.9km (490.2mi), or less than half that of the Moon, but slightly more than Rhea, the second-largest satellite of Saturn, making Titania the eighth-largest moon in the Solar System. [16] The total mass of ice in Uranus's interior is not precisely known, because different figures emerge depending on the model chosen; it must be between 9.3and 13.5Earth masses. The French astronomer Pierre Charles Le Monnier observed Uranus at least twelve times between 1750 and 1769,[26] including on four consecutive nights. [91] The heating of the stratosphere is caused by absorption of solar UV and IR radiation by methane and other hydrocarbons,[102] which form in this part of the atmosphere as a result of methane photolysis. Uranus, in Greek mythology, the personification of heaven.
